I just put a new crate engine in my 86 and while doing so, I installed an Edelbrock Performer non EGR intake manifold and Edelbrock Performer carb with B&M TV adapter. I installed the OEM throttle cable/tv cable bracket only to find that the tv cable does not line up. I should have known.
What kind of bracket is available to fit this that will work with no fuss? I am ready to drive this sucker and quit working on it.

Bunch of post on this, but don't drive it without it being connected if its a 700R4 Overdrive:

Yowser! She is running like a champ! That old 305 never ran this good. The base crate engine was a nice upgrade. BTW, I used an Edelbrock carb, intake and Edelbrock 8031 bracket. I still had to add a 1" spacer to the bracket to get the cables in line with the carburetor linkage. Go figure.
